SAAB has been in trouble for years...mainly from the public's perspective. My brother was a rep for them in 5 diff states and they were always the odd man out. We both worked Dallas for a time, and I was the BMW rep and he the SAAB rep. In the biz, there is what we call the "mental shopping list" - that most people had. When 90% of the public would go looking for luxury imports, they went to BMW, Benz, Lexus, audi, Infiniti and Acura - pretty much in that order. The other guys sell to eclectic people who like the diff type stuff. They never could fill their showrooms with the Mainstream shoppers. We always would compare traffic counts from the weekend and I was always 5 to 1 vs his dealers.
I don't agree with the above, but it is "the way it is"...Lack of volume killed SAAB in a down market.
